{Mini Bobcat vs. Skid Steer for Land Removal
When facing a land removal , choosing the right equipment is vital. Both {mini diggers and Bobcats have their benefits, but they excel in different ways. Mini excavators typically grant superior excavation power and accuracy , making them ideal for heavy timber and functioning in confined zones. Skid steers, on the alternative hand, provide more versatility thanks to their power to readily attach various attachments, such as scoops , claw , and rotary tillers . Consider the nature of vegetation and the reachability of the location to select which machine is the best .

Site Clearing Expenses : What to Anticipate & How to Reduce
Clearing land for a upcoming building can bring about considerable fees. You might encounter charges ranging from hundreds of pounds, dependent on variables such as the scope of the plot, existing vegetation density , and any essential ecological permits . Typical expenses involve tree removal, debris grinding, rock removal, and shaping the ground . To decrease these budget burdens, evaluate getting several estimates from qualified contractors, opting for less busy clearing dates , and carefully determining the need for thorough clearing versus a more selective method .

Homeowner Land Preparation with a Compact Loader – Tips & Safety
So, you're wanting to remove land independently with a skid steer ? That’s great ! However, it’s crucial to understand both the procedure and the hazards involved. Operating a machine for land preparation is significant and demands careful planning . Here's some key considerations and protective measures:
- Evaluate the area : Look for buried pipes – call before you remove! Also , mark any rocks that could harm your machinery .
- Don appropriate attire: This encompasses a helmet , safety glasses , hand coverings, and heavy boots .
- Understand your loader's limits : Don’t push it beyond what it can do. Review the operator's manual thoroughly.
- Maintain a clear area from others: Ensure bystanders at a respectful distance during operations .
- Watch for above wires and uneven terrain .
Remember that DIY land preparation can be demanding. If you lack experience, hire a professional land clearing company.
